+changeset: 5625:99175953520e
+branch: maint-1.6
+parent: 5537:d698d3d843a9
+user: Joseph Myers <jsm@polyomino.org.uk>
+date: Mon Aug 20 00:50:16 2018 +0000
+files: CHANGES.txt roundup/configuration.py
+description:
+Fix issue2550994: breakage caused by configparser backports.
+
+
+diff -r d698d3d843a9 -r 99175953520e roundup/configuration.py
+--- a/roundup/configuration.py Thu Sep 06 17:04:49 2018 -0400
++++ b/roundup/configuration.py Mon Aug 20 00:50:16 2018 +0000
+@@ -2,9 +2,15 @@
+ #
+ __docformat__ = "restructuredtext"
+
+-try:
++# Some systems have a backport of the Python 3 configparser module to
++# Python 2: <https://pypi.org/project/configparser/>. That breaks
++# Roundup if used with Python 2 because it generates unicode objects
++# where not expected by the Python code. Thus, a version check is
++# used here instead of try/except.
++import sys
++if sys.version_info[0] > 2:
+ import configparser # Python 3
+-except ImportError:
++else:
+ import ConfigParser as configparser # Python 2
+
+ import getopt
+@@ -12,7 +18,6 @@
+ import logging, logging.config
+ import os
+ import re
+-import sys
+ import time
+ import smtplib
+

+changeset: 5629:8e3df461d316
+branch: maint-1.6
+user: John Rouillard <rouilj@ieee.org>
+date: Wed Feb 27 21:47:39 2019 -0500
+files: CHANGES.txt roundup/cgi/client.py roundup/scripts/roundup_server.py test/test_cgi.py
+description:
+issue2551023: Fix CSRF headers for use with wsgi and cgi. The
+env variable array used - separators rather than _. Compare:
+HTTP_X-REQUESTED-WITH to HTTP_X_REQUESTED_WITH. The last is
+correct. Also fix roundup-server to produce the latter form. (Patch
+by Cédric Krier)
+
+
+diff -r 64ceb9c14b28 -r 8e3df461d316 roundup/cgi/client.py
+--- a/roundup/cgi/client.py Tue Feb 12 21:31:41 2019 -0500
++++ b/roundup/cgi/client.py Wed Feb 27 21:47:39 2019 -0500
+@@ -1026,7 +1026,7 @@
+ # If required headers are missing, raise an error
+ for header in header_names:
+ if (config["WEB_CSRF_ENFORCE_HEADER_%s"%header] == 'required'
+- and "HTTP_%s"%header not in self.env):
++ and "HTTP_%s" % header.replace('-', '_') not in self.env):
+ logger.error(self._("csrf header %s required but missing for user%s."), header, current_user)
+ raise Unauthorised, self._("Missing header: %s")%header
+
+@@ -1062,9 +1062,9 @@
+ header_pass += 1
+
+ enforce=config['WEB_CSRF_ENFORCE_HEADER_X-FORWARDED-HOST']
+- if 'HTTP_X-FORWARDED-HOST' in self.env:
++ if 'HTTP_X_FORWARDED_HOST' in self.env:
+ if enforce != "no":
+- host = self.env['HTTP_X-FORWARDED-HOST']
++ host = self.env['HTTP_X_FORWARDED_HOST']
+ foundat = self.base.find('://' + host + '/')
+ # 4 means self.base has http:/ prefix, 5 means https:/ prefix
+ if foundat not in [4, 5]:
+@@ -1111,7 +1111,7 @@
+ # Note we do not use CSRF nonces for xmlrpc requests.
+ #
+ # see: https://www.owasp.org/index.php/Cross-Site_Request_Forgery_(CSRF)_Prevention_Cheat_Sheet#Protecting_REST_Services:_Use_of_Custom_Request_Headers
+- if 'HTTP_X-REQUESTED-WITH' not in self.env:
++ if 'HTTP_X_REQUESTED_WITH' not in self.env:
+ logger.error(self._("csrf X-REQUESTED-WITH xmlrpc required header check failed for user%s."), current_user)
+ raise UsageError, self._("Required Header Missing")
+
